The Rival Herb Tablets Tin is a quintessential artifact of the early 20th-century 'quack medicine' era, produced by the Rival Herb Company of Detroit and Montreal. These tins are highly collectible for their bold red lithography and their history as a marketed cure-all for stomach, liver, and kidney ailments.

History of Rival Herb Tablets Tin

Produced by the Rival Herb Company of Detroit and Montreal, these tablets were part of the 'quack medicine' era. They were marketed as a cure-all for stomach, liver, and kidney issues. This specific tin design was common in the early 1900s and reflects the graphic style of pharmaceutical advertising before the stricter regulations of the mid-20th century.
